In-8, broché, sous couverture papier moderne, (2), 92 p. Rare édition originale et unique de cet essai attribué à Pierre-Hyacinthe Duvigneau (1752-1794) par Hervé Leuwers ('L'invention du barreau français, 1660-1830', Paris, EHESS, 2006, p. 257 note 33). Avocat puis procureur au parlement, il fut guillotiné en 1794. Il est également l'auteur de comédies et de cantates, rédacteur des "Annales de la municipalité de Bordeaux et du département de la Gironde" (1790-1791). "Le 8 février, il paraît [cette] brochure où le patriotisme triomphe de tous les sophismes dont les royalistes ont voulu faire usage pour le combattre. L'auteur anonyme défend vigoureusement le Parlement de toutes les inculpations vagues dont on l'a chargé, et finit par désirer que l'on substitue les États provinciaux au régime politique imaginé par la Cour. Il y a de la chaleur, de la raison et de l'ordre dans cet écrit" (Pierre Bernadau, 'Les débuts de la révolution à Bordeaux', p. 10). In-8, broché sous couture, 20 p., non rogné. Edition à la date de l'originale de ce document historique: les remontrances par lesquelles le Parlement de Paris notifie son refus d'enregistrer les édits fiscaux que lui présente Brienne, et où il réclame, pour la première fois, la tenue d'Etats-Généraux. Louis XVI réagit rapidement en convoquant un Lit de Justice qui force l'enregistrement, retire au Parlement le contrôle législatif et fiscal et l'exile à Troyes en provoquant une violente réaction des parlements de province et de l'opinion publique. Les remontrances proprement dites sont suivies d la "Réponse du roi". Cet acte constitue l'un des événements majeurs dans le déclenchement de l'agitation prérévolutionnaire. IN 8°, pp.XI, 479. LEGATURA IN MEZZA PELLE D'EPOCA, PIATTI RIGIDI CARTA MARMORIZZATA. <BR>FRANCESCO STRANI ( BIBBIENA 1784 - MASSA 1855 ), VESCOVO CATTOLICO ITALIANO. NEL 1834 IL 23 GIUGNO, PAPA GREGORIO XVI LO NOMINA VESVOVO DI MASSA. FU CONSACRATO VESCOVO IL 6 LUGLIO DAL CARDINALE CARLO ODESCALCHI VICARIO DEL PAPA. SONO GLI ATTI DEL PRIMO SINODO DELLA DIOCESI DI MASSA, 10-11-12 SETTEMBRE 1839. IL 13 IL VESCOVO CONSACRO LA CHIESA DI S. PIETRO E S. FRANCESCO QUALE CATTEDRALE DELLA NUOVA DIOCESI.
